Former Real Madrid midfield icon Toni Kroos has shared his thoughts on Arda Guler’s role in the new-look Real Madrid under Xabi Alonso.

Speaking on his regular podcast Einfach mal Luppen, which he co-hosts with his brother Felix, the retired German midfielder made it clear he’s a big fan of the Turkish youngster’s talent.

Kroos highlighted Guler’s unique ability to move between the lines and create attacking opportunities.

“When you have a player like him, who knows how to find space, you can forgive him if he loses a duel now and then,” Kroos explained.

However, he also pointed out that this freedom in attack doesn’t mean ignoring defensive duties. “The important thing is that he understands his role in the team and joins the collective effort when defending,” he added.

Guler ready for bigger role

Kroos believes the timing is perfect for Guler to take on more responsibility at Real Madrid.

“Last year, he already had the technical level with the ball, but now physically he has also taken a step forward. He’s ready,” said Kroos, who knows exactly what it takes to succeed in Madrid’s midfield.

The former midfielder also spoke about the importance of team defence, something Xabi Alonso is trying to build his new Madrid project around.

“When everyone defends together, the team benefits. Recovering the ball gives energy. If you don’t press or help defensively, you will end up chasing the ball the whole game.

“That was one of the big problems last year,” Kroos admitted.

Looking at the bigger picture, Kroos shared his belief that having a clear system is the first step when building a team with a new coach. “You have to know what the plan is and then choose the players that fit that idea best.”

To close, Kroos expressed his full support for Alonso. Despite only sharing the dressing room briefly with him during his playing days, Kroos is confident in Alonso’s leadership.

“I have a lot of trust in Xabi. He has a clear vision and knows how to get his message across. If they defend well, they’ll attack even better,” he concluded.
